ConnMgrReleaseConnection

This function deletes a specified connection request, potentially dropping the physical connection.

Syntax

HRESULT WINAPI ConnMgrReleaseConnection(
  HANDLE   hConnection,
  LONG     lCache 
);

Parameters

  • lCache
    [in] The number of seconds to cache the connection before disconnection occurs. This parameter accepts values described in the following table.

    Value Description

    A value greater than 1

    The number of seconds to cache the connection before disconnection occurs.

    1

    The default cache time value, as specified by the H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\Comm\ConnMgr\Planner\Settings registry key. The CacheTime registry setting defines the default for nonexclusive connections and the VPNCacheTime registry setting defines the default for exclusive connections.

    0

    Note

    Some Windows Mobile devices ignore the specified value of this parameter and instead use the default value (60 seconds).

Return Values

Returns S_OK if successful or an error code if the function call failed.

Remarks

Connection Manager does not cache the following types of connections:

  • Suspended connections
  • Disconnected connections
  • Connections without a DestId (that is, when the connection was provisioned using provisioning XML, a DestId was not specified)
  • Fixed path connections (that is, a connection where the destination GUID is set to be an existing network connection that is managed with Connection Manager)
